Stamp Duty in West Bengal (Updated 2026)

Stamp duty in West Bengal is a mandatory tax levied on property-related transactions such as sale deeds, gift deeds, mortgage agreements, lease deeds, and exchange deeds. It is calculated on the higher of the property’s market value or the agreement value.

The applicable stamp duty depends on several factors:

  • Property value
  • Location (urban vs rural)
  • Type of transaction
  • Government rebates (if applicable)

Stamp Duty & Registration Charges in West Bengal (2026)

As of 2026, the West Bengal government has largely continued the revised stamp duty structure introduced earlier, though temporary rebates may be announced periodically depending on policy.

Current Standard Rates

  • Up to ₹25 lakh5% stamp duty
  • Above ₹25 lakh6% stamp duty
  • Registration Charges1% of property value

These rates are applicable across most urban areas, including Kolkata, Howrah, and Siliguri.

Important Update (2026)

  • Earlier rebates (like 2% stamp duty discount and 10% circle rate reduction) were temporary and may not always be active.
  • Always verify the latest notification before property registration.

Stamp Duty in Major Cities (2026 Overview)

City≤ ₹25 Lakh> ₹25 LakhRegistration Fee
Kolkata5%6%1%
Durgapur5%6%1%
Howrah5%6%1%
Siliguri5%6%1%
Kharagpur5%6%1%
  • No special gender-based concession is currently applied (same rates for all buyers).

How to Calculate Stamp Duty & Registration Charges (2026)

You can calculate charges online through the official portal:

  1. Visit Directorate of Registration and Stamp Revenue West Bengal
  2. Go to E-Services
  3. Select “Stamp Duty & Registration Fee Calculator”
  4. Enter property details (location, value, type)
  5. View exact payable amount instantly

How to Pay Stamp Duty Online in West Bengal

Follow these steps:

  1. Visit the GRIPS Portal (Government Receipt Portal System)
  2. Select:
    • Directorate of Registration & Stamp Revenue
    • Stamp Duty & Registration Fee Payment
  3. Enter details from your e-assessment slip
  4. Choose payment method (Net Banking / Card / NEFT)
  5. Download the e-challan (GRN & BRN) for records

Refund of Stamp Duty (2026 Process)

If excess or incorrect payment is made:

  1. Visit the official WB Registration portal
  2. Go to E-Services → E-payment & Refund
  3. Select Refund Application
  4. Enter:
    • Query Number
    • Year
    • GRN Number
  5. Submit request for processing

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Is stamp duty applicable on gifted or inherited property?

Yes. Stamp duty is applicable in both cases, though concessional rates may apply depending on the relationship and transaction type.

2. What happens if stamp duty is not paid?

Non-payment or underpayment can attract penalties ranging from:
2% to 200% of the unpaid stamp duty amount
